Taxonomy & naming
Parodon suborbitalis was described by the French zoologist Achille Valenciennes in 1850. It belongs to the genus Parodon, the type genus of the family Parodontidae — a distinct lineage within Characiformes, separate from Serrasalmidae (piranhas and pacus) and from the true tetra families. The Catalog of Fishes (Eschmeyer, California Academy of Sciences) is the governing authority on the valid name and placement; nothing in the available sources suggests the species has been moved from Parodon since its original description.
Parodontidae as a whole is a small, specialised family of South American "scraper" characins, distinguished by a distinctive jaw structure adapted for grazing periphyton rather than the more generalist or predatory feeding modes seen elsewhere in the order. Morphology
Parodon suborbitalis is a small, elongate, fusiform characin reaching a documented maximum of 5 in standard length, with most individuals seen in trade and in the wild running smaller. The body plan is built for holding position and grazing in current: a streamlined, slightly compressed torpedo shape, a subterminal (underslung) mouth positioned for scraping surfaces rather than snatching food from midwater, and specialised, closely set teeth suited to rasping algae and biofilm from rock and wood surfaces.
Colouration in Parodon species is typically a muted silver-to-olive base, often with a dark lateral stripe or series of blotches running along the flank — camouflage suited to a fish that spends much of its time close to structured, current-swept substrate rather than in open water. Habitat
The species is native to the Lake Maracaibo basin and the Orinoco River basin of Venezuela and Colombia, where it inhabits fast-flowing river reaches. FishBase describes it as a benthopelagic freshwater fish, consistent with a grazer that holds station near the bottom in current rather than ranging through the water column. Recorded water temperature in the wild is 73–79 °F.
Hobby-source water parameters for aquarium keeping (drawn from the German Fischlexikon database) put pH at roughly 6.0–7.5 and general hardness at 5–15 °dGH — moderate, close-to-neutral water rather than extreme soft blackwater. Feeding
Parodon suborbitalis is a grazer, not a predator: FishBase and the Fischlexikon aquarium database both record its diet as algae and aquatic insects (insect larvae), consistent with the family's specialised scraping dentition. This places it firmly among the quiet, detritus- and biofilm-grazing characins of this broader group, alongside the hemiodus and curimatas, and well away from the predatory or omnivorous-scavenging habits seen in piranhas or Brycon.
In the aquarium this translates to a fish that benefits from established surfaces to graze — driftwood, rock and mature tank walls with a natural algae film — supplemented with sinking algae wafers, spirulina-based foods and small live or frozen foods such as bloodworm or daphnia to cover the insect-larvae component of its natural diet. In the aquarium
Parodon suborbitalis stays modest in size (to roughly 4.5 in) but is a true schooling fish, and hobby sources recommend keeping it in a group of eight or more rather than as a pair or trio. The Fischlexikon database recommends a minimum aquarium of around 100 US gal with a footprint of at least 59 in in length — sized generously for a small fish precisely because it is a current-loving, active grazer that needs room to hold station and patrol, not because it grows large.
Dense planting, along with driftwood and stone for shelter and grazing surface, is recommended, together with pH 6.0–7.5, hardness 5–15 °dGH and a temperature of 73–79 °F. It is a peaceful species suited to a community of similarly current-tolerant South American fish, with no fin-nipping or aggression documented.
Conservation
The IUCN Red List assesses Parodon suborbitalis as Vulnerable (VU), a status corroborated across every source in the cache. The assessment PDF itself was not directly retrievable (HTTP 403), so the precise criteria and rationale text could not be confirmed firsthand for this article; FishBase separately records the assessment date as 27 August 2020 under criteria B2ab(iii), indicating a restricted and/or declining area of occupancy.
As a species confined to the Lake Maracaibo and Orinoco basins, it is exposed to the general pressures facing freshwater fish in those systems — habitat degradation, water-quality decline and land-use change in the lake's watershed in particular.
